Dream Free has a first start for David Pipe on the Flat since joining the yard a year or so ago and looks fairly treated. Finley Marsh claims a useful 3lb and the gelding's efforts this year over hurdles have proved quite encouraging. In contrast, Purple Jazz doesn't seem to have enjoyed his time over timber and should relish the return to the Flat, having scored for George Baker at Lingfield last summer. Sunshineandbubbles has claims on an improved showing latest but MISS M makes most appeal. She only has the one career success to date but shaped quite nicely on her return from a break last month and her consistency should see her competitive once again.
